Examining the Damage

Before diving into the repair procedure, it's vital to examine the level of the damage. Not all fractures are produced equal, and the type and area of the crack will determine the very best course of action.

  1. Type of Crack:

    • Hairline Cracks: These are thin, superficial cracks that normally do not compromise the window's structural stability. They can typically be fixed with a DIY set.
    • Stress Cracks: These are more significant fractures that can occur due to thermal growth and contraction. They may require expert attention.
    • Effect Cracks: These are cracks brought on by external forces, such as a rock or ball. They can be deep and may demand a complete replacement.
  2. Area of the Crack:

    • Edge Cracks: Cracks near the edges of the window repairing are more most likely to spread and can be more challenging to repair.
    • Center Cracks: Cracks in the center of the window are generally much easier to handle and may not need a full replacement.
  3. Depth of the Crack:

    • Surface Cracks: These are shallow and can typically be buffed out or filled.
    • Deep Cracks: These penetrate the glass and may require a more substantial upvc door repair near me or replacement.

Tools and Materials Needed

Before you start the repair, collect the required tools and materials. The specific products will depend upon the type and extent of the damage, but here are some common items you may require:

  • Safety Gear: Gloves, safety glasses, and a dust mask.
  • Cleaning Supplies: Soap, water, and a clean cloth.
  • Drill and Drill Bits: For creating holes to inject repair resin.
  • Resin Kit: For filling the crack.
  • UV Light: To treat the resin.
  • Putty Knife: For getting rid of old putty or caulk.
  • Caulk or Silicone Sealant: For sealing the edges of the window.
  • Replacement Glass: If the fracture is too substantial for repair.

Step-by-Step Repair Process

  1. Prepare the Area:

    • Safety First: Put on your safety gear to secure yourself from glass shards and chemicals.
    • Tidy the Window: Use soap and water to clean the location around the fracture. Guarantee the surface area is dry before proceeding.
  2. Drill Holes (If Necessary):

    • For deeper fractures, drill small holes at the ends of the crack to avoid it from spreading out. Use a drill bit that is somewhat smaller sized than the crack width.
  3. Use the Resin:

    • Inject the Resin: Using the syringe offered in the resin package, inject the resin into the fracture. Start from the bottom and work your method up.
    • Fill the Holes: If you drilled holes, fill them with resin as well.
  4. Treat the Resin:

    • UV Light: Use a UV light to treat the resin. Follow the maker's instructions for the treating time, which can vary from a few minutes to numerous hours.
    • Natural Sunlight: If a UV light is not readily available, put the window in direct sunlight to treat the resin.
  5. Smooth the Surface:

    • Once the resin is cured, utilize a putty knife to smooth the surface area. Sand any rough locations with fine-grit sandpaper.
  6. Seal the Edges:

    • Apply a thin layer of caulk or silicone sealant around the edges of the window to guarantee a water tight seal.
  7. Check the Window:

    • Once the sealant is dry, evaluate the window for leaks by running water over it. If water seeps through, use extra sealant as needed.

When to Call a Professional

While lots of small cracks can be fixed with a DIY package, there are scenarios where professional help is essential:

  • Large or Multiple Cracks: If the window has numerous fractures or the fracture is substantial, it might be more affordable to replace the window.
  • Structural Damage: If the crack has jeopardized the structural integrity of the window, a specialist can assess and repair the damage.
  • Old or Historic Windows: If your home has old or historical windows, a professional can make sure that the repair matches the initial style and products.

Frequently asked questions

Q: Can a cracked window be fixed, or does it always need to be replaced?A: Many small fractures can be repaired using a DIY set, but bigger or more complicated cracks may require a complete replacement. Examine the type and extent of the damage to figure out the very best course of action.

Q: How long does it take for the resin to treat?A: The treating time for the resin can differ depending on the product. Most resins cure within a couple of minutes to several hours when exposed to UV light or sunlight. Constantly follow the maker's instructions.

Q: Can I repair a broken window myself, or should I employ a professional?A: For small, shallow cracks, a DIY repair is typically adequate. However, if the fracture is deep or substantial, or if the window belongs to a historical or valuable structure, it's best to seek advice from an expert.

Q: How much does it cost to repair a broken window?A: The cost of fixing a split emergency window repair can vary commonly depending on the kind of repair required. Do it yourself sets are reasonably low-cost, ranging from ₤ 20 to ₤ 50. Expert repairs can cost numerous hundred dollars, and replacement windows can cost anywhere from ₤ 100 to ₤ 1,000 or more, depending on the size and material.

Q: Will a repaired fracture show up?A: While an expert repair can lessen presence, some cracks might still be obvious. The objective is to bring back the window's stability and functionality, even if the repair is not completely unnoticeable.
